All integers are rational numbers true or false

a rational number is defined as a number that can be expressed in the form a/b where b≠0

the set of integers includes positive and negative counting numbers and 0
so like -4,-3,-2,-1,0,1,2,3,4.... etc

any integer can be written as the same integer over 1
some examples

-4=-4/1
3=3/1
100=100/1
etc
so yes, any integer can be expressed as a rational number
